The Historical Context and Current Concerns

Historically, June has not been kind to Ethereum, with eight out of eleven Junes ending in the red since 2016.

Key player Tom Lee elaborated on the recent sell-off, attributing it to "window dressing" practices. Fund managers often sell struggling assets before quarter-end reporting, leading to downward pressures. "Noooo!!!" exclaimed a frustrated commenter, reflecting the mood.

Ongoing Governance Drama in ENS DAO

In addition to price discussions, governance issues are surfacing within the ENS DAO. A proposal to transfer control of the DAO treasury to the ENS Foundation is stirring debate, with accusations of a β€œgovernance attack.” Critics argue the move could be an attempt at treasury capture. "The proposal is still in the discussion phase," confirmed a user, emphasizing the ongoing unrest.
